我正在为客户做一个项目,交付成果是一个轻量级的 Linux 发行版(由于熟悉,我使用 Lubuntu 而不是 Puppy 或 Mint),可以从 8/16GB USB 驱动器实时启动,启动时运行一个脚本,该脚本会自动向指定的电子邮件地址和电话号码发送电子邮件/短信(不太清楚电话号码如何处理),并安装了一些特定的程序
首先,这可能吗?我曾经有过这样的服务器,我们的 SysAds 编写了脚本,当服务器重新启动或存档时,这些脚本会向整个发行版列表发送电子邮件 - 那是在 RHEL/CentOS 上 - 我还没有在 Lubuntu 上尝试过它。
我尝试在 UNetBootin 中创建永久驱动器,但它不会保存任何更改,并且我为推荐的安装分配了足够的空间(4.6GB)。我读过这个教程:将 Lubuntu 完整安装到 USB 驱动器上,一旦我获得另一张 CD/USB,我就会尝试它 - 除非有办法将安装程序作为独立程序下载,否则我在 2 台不同的生产笔记本电脑上安装了完整版的 Lubuntu。
如果我使用上面列出的方法,我假设我可以执行所有脚本,并下载/删除我需要的程序,这样就可以保存了?或者我可以使用 Ubuntu 自定义工具包修改 Lubuntu 吗?创建自定义的 Ubuntu Live USB) 并从那里完成我需要的所有工作然后进行自定义 Live USB 安装?
至于发送电子邮件/消息的脚本 - 我知道我至少需要发送邮件,还有其他在线资源可以访问吗?我看过 Arch 和 CentOS 的教程 - 但没有 Lubuntu 的教程。我需要的程序是 aircrack-ng 套件、wireshark、TOR、Abiword 和 Sendmail,然后删除其他任何东西 - 这在 Lubuntu 上也可以做到吗?我只在 Kali 上使用这些网络工具来工作。
抱歉,帖子太长了,我是一名职业 PM - 所以我确信我明白一些完全 FUBAR 的意思,提前谢谢你。